Conférence : Vulnérabilité des sols alpins face au réchauffement climatique
Marc André Sélosse, the great French biologist, refers to the soil as 'the origin of the world'. Soil plays a fundamental role in Alpine ecosystems.
At a time of global change, although soils are at the heart of major environmental and societal issues (carbon storage, regulation of the water cycle, plant nutrition), their functions are becoming both vulnerable and threatened.
Rising temperatures, which are all the more marked in mountain ecosystems, are changing not only the duration of snow cover but also all the seasonal cycles that used to depend on it.
So we invite you to set off on a voyage of discovery of the unjustly little-known soils, to understand the roles they play for human and non-human societies, and the threats they face.
